How much does it cost to rent an apartment in St Pete Beach?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cheap St Pete Beach Studio Apartments | $1,446 | $1,095 | $1,600 |
| Cheap St Pete Beach 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,059 | $1,303 | $3,851 |
| Cheap St Pete Beach 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,621 | $1,675 | $4,768 |
| Cheap St Pete Beach 3 Bedroom Apartments | $9,224 | $5,495 | $10,000+ |

Cheapest Available St Pete Beach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in St Pete Beach, FL is a Studio unit found at Bay Pointe Tower in the Sunset Beach neighborhood priced from $1,460. 2820 DuPont St S in the Belle Vista ne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 2 Beds apartment currently listed from $1,675. Here is today’s list of the most affordable St Pete Beach apartments for rent: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bay Pointe Tower | S1 | Studio,1BA | $1,460 |
| 2820 DuPont St S | 201 | 2BR,1BA | $1,675 |
| Splendid unit near the beach | Walk to the beach | 2BR,1BA | $1,895 |
| Waters Pointe | B1 | 2BR,1BA | $2,140 |
